A tail lift is a mechanical device installed at the rear of a truck or van that assists in the loading and unloading of goods. It typically consists of a platform that can be raised and lowered using hydraulic power, allowing for smooth transitions between the vehicle and the ground.
Hydraulic Tail Lifts: These use hydraulic systems to lift and lower the platform, providing powerful lifting capabilities.
Pneumatic Tail Lifts: These operate using air pressure and are generally lighter but may not handle as heavy loads as hydraulic lifts.
Cantilever Tail Lifts: These extend outward and are ideal for tight spaces, allowing for easy access to the cargo area.
Tuck-Under Tail Lifts: These tuck under the vehicle when not in use, providing a clean look and saving space.
One of the primary safety benefits of advanced tail lifts is the reduction of manual handling. Heavy lifting can lead to injuries such as strains, sprains, and other musculoskeletal disorders. By using a tail lift, operators can load and unload goods without the need for manual lifting, significantly reducing the risk of injury.
Advanced tail lifts are designed with stability in mind. Many models feature anti-slip surfaces and safety rails, providing a secure platform for operators to work from. Additionally, hydraulic systems offer precise control over lifting and lowering actions, allowing operators to position loads accurately and safely.
Modern tail lifts come equipped with various safety features, including:
Emergency Stop Buttons: Allow operators to halt operations immediately in case of an emergency.
Load Sensors: Prevent the lift from operating if the load exceeds its capacity, reducing the risk of accidents.
Safety Locks: Ensure that the lift remains securely in place when not in use.
Many advanced tail lifts are designed with visibility in mind. Features such as LED lights and reflective markings enhance visibility during nighttime operations, ensuring that operators can work safely in low-light conditions.

Regular maintenance is essential for ensuring the safety and efficiency of tail lifts. This includes checking hydraulic fluid levels, inspecting hoses and connections, and ensuring that all safety features are functioning correctly.
Proper training for operators is crucial. Operators should be trained on how to use the tail lift safely, including how to load and unload goods correctly and how to respond in case of an emergency.
Operators should always ensure that loads are within the tail lift's capacity. Overloading can lead to accidents and damage to the lift. Additionally, loads should be secured properly to prevent shifting during transport.
Operators should wear appropriate PPE, such as safety vests, gloves, and steel-toed boots, to protect themselves while operating the tail lift.
